Job Description

Position Summary The Maintenance Tech will modify, repair, and improve existing products, and equipment, and will assist in developing new or updated machinery, components, or products. The incumbent will assist with maintenance repairs and installations as necessary. Key Duties and Responsibilities Training and development of Site Managers to ensure that they can maintain 75% of their sites with preventative maintenance measures. Use tools ranging from common hand and power tools, such as hammers, hoists, saws, drills, and wrenches, hydraulic, electrical, and electronic testing devices. Perform routine preventive and predictive maintenance as per the schedule to ensure that machines continue. to run smoothly, building systems operate efficiently, and the physical condition of buildings does not. deteriorate. Inspect, operate, or test machinery or equipment to diagnose machine malfunctions. Diagnose mechanical problems and determine how to correct them, checking repair manuals, or parts catalogs, as necessary. Assemble, install, or repair wiring, electrical or electronic components, pipe systems, plumbing, machinery, or equipment. Inspect gages, valves, pressure regulators, drives, motors, and belts, check fluid levels, replace filters, or perform. other maintenance responsibilities. Report any accident that occurred in the building related to a person, equipment, material, or any other to the operations director as soon as possible. Clean or lubricate shafts, bearings, gears, or other parts of machinery during maintenance or repair. Will ensure critical spare parts/inventory are on site. Assist with acquisition / new site installations. Determines material or replacement needs and a logical method for repair; takes appropriate action to meet those needs and makes repairs. Performs safety checks to ensure design plans are feasible in various conditions. Reports potentially dangerous electrical equipment to the supervisor and takes steps to resolve the issue. Instructs employees regarding safe working procedures and requirements when working with electronic equipment and components. Develops and maintains records related to electronic and electrical equipment, and reports project status to management. Performs other related duties as assigned.
